CEG vs FE in plain English
- CEG is the bigger company — about 3.6× the market cap of FE.
- FE is cheaper on earnings (P/E 25.0 vs 27.2).
- CEG earns a higher return on equity (15% vs 9%).
- CEG is growing revenue faster (23% vs 9%).
- FE has the higher dividend yield (3.97% vs 0.61%).
